About Tata Chemicals Ltd

Tata Chemicals Ltd is in the Chemicals sector, having a market capitalization of Rs. 28398.1 crores. It has reported a sales of Rs. 1093 crores and a net profit of Rs. 115 crores for the quarter ended December 2018. The company management includes N Chandrasekaran, Rajiv Chandan,R Mukundan,Vibha Paul Rishi,S Padmanabhan,Ratan N Tata,Padmini Khare Kaicker,Zarir Langrana,C V Natraj,K B S Anand,N Chandrasekaran,Rajiv Dube (Tata Chemicals Ltd) among others.

Does Tata Chemicals have any debts?

The company's gross debt and net debt stood at Rs. 6,476 crores and Rs. 4,357 crores, respectively, as of December 2022. An increase of Rs. 125 crores has been driven primarily by adverse exchange rate movements.

Is Tata Chemicals' stock price expected to rise?

There’s no foolproof method for predicting the price of a stock. However, driven by newer applications like solar glass and lithium-ion batteries, Tata Chemicals expects a demand bias in the soda ash market in FY24.

What is the business plan for Tata Chemicals?

Tata Chemicals, the world’s second-largest soda ash company, has now identified the food and nourishment platform and the farm input platform as the two key pillars for growth. Furthermore, the company's Europe arm, Tata Chemicals Europe, has set up the UK’s first industrial-scale carbon capture and usage plant in June 2022.
